#a80606 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a80606 is composed of 65.9% red, 2.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.4%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 34.1%. #a80606 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c0c with #510000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a80606 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a80606 has RGB values of R:168, G:6,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.96,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11011590.

Shades and Tints of #a80606
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100101 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a80606
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585656 is the less saturated color, while #a80606 is the most saturated one.
